Monoprice Monolith HTP-1 Surround Sound Processor Review Specs

Specs
AUTO SETUP/ROOM EQ: Dirac Live
VIDEO PROCESSING: None; pass-through up to 4K
DIMENSIONS: (W x H x D, Inches): 17.1 x 5.7 x 12
WEIGHT: (Pounds): 16
VIDEO INPUTS: HDMI 2.0b (8)
AUDIOINPUTS: Coaxial digital (3), optical digital (3), stereo analog RCA (2)
ADDITIONAL:
VIDEO OUTPUTS: HDMI 2.0 (2, 1 w/eARC)
AUDIO OUTPUTS: Stereo analog XLR Balanced (16), stereo analog RCA
ADDITIONAL: USB type-B Ethernet, 12-volt trigger (4-out, 1-in), Bluetooth, Roon endpoint
Price: $3,999
